<\/amp-ad><\/p>\n The Big Bang theory states that the universe was formed by expanding from a singular point. As this expansion continued, hydrogen, helium, and minor amounts of lithium emerged. When these gases reached extremely low temperatures, galaxies such as the Milky Way and Andromeda were formed. <\/p>\n Although this theory is called the Big Bang, the main event is expansion. The explosion in a small moment in time did not occur in space.<\/p>\n From this moment on, the universe continues to expand, as it does today. What happened after the Big Bang has always been the subject of debate. The theory that most scientists agree with is as follows:<\/p>\n At the initial stage, the universe was quite hot and dense. This homogeneous universe was becoming more and more swollen, completely surrounded by quark-gluon. The cooling phase also started after that.<\/p>\nHow Did the Universe Form?<\/h2>\n
